首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
设有如下定义 struct ss { char name[10]; int age; char sex; } std[3],*p=std; 下面各输入语句中错误的是
设有如下定义 struct ss { char name[10]; int age; char sex; } std[3],*p=std; 下面各输入语句中错误的是
admin
2013-06-11
99
问题
设有如下定义 struct ss { char name[10]; int age; char sex; } std[3],*p=std; 下面各输入语句中错误的是
选项
A、scanf("%d",&(*p).age);
B、scant("%s",&std.name);
C、scanf("%c",&std[0].sex);
D、scanf("%c",&(p->sex));
答案
2
解析
选项A中“&(*p).age”代表的是etd[0].age的地址,是正确的,选项C也是正确的,选项D先用指针变量引用结构型的成员sex,然后取它的地址,也是正确的,选项B中的“std.name”是错误的引用,因为std是数组名,代表的是数组的首地址,地址没有成员“name”。
转载请注明原文地址:https://kaotiyun.com/show/3xJ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列叙述中正确的是______。
以下程序的输出结果是【 】。#include<stdlib.h>main(){char*s1,*s2,m;s1=s2=(char*)malloc(sizeof(char));*s1=15;*s2=20;
有以下程序 #include<string.h> main() { char p[20]={’a’,’b’,’c’,’d’},q[]="abc",r[]="abcde"; strcpy(p+strlen(q),r);strcat
已知大写字母A的ASCII码是65,小写字母a的ASCII码是97。以下不能将变量c中的大写字母转换为对应小写字母的语句是
设变量均已正确定义,若要通过scanf("%d%c%d%c",&a1,&c1,&a2,&c2);语句为变量a1和a2赋数值 10和20,为变量c1和c2赋字符X和Y。以下所示的输入形式中正确的是(注:口代表空格字符)
下列叙述中,错误的是______。
在结构化设计方法中生成的结构图(SC)中,带有圆圈的小箭头表示()。
有一个数值152,它与十六进制数6A相等,那么该数值是()
对于建立良好的程序设计风格,下面描述正确的是()。
在printf格式字符中,以带符号的十进制形式输出整数的格式字符是【】;以八进制无符号形式输出整数的格式字符是【】;以十六进制无符号形式输出整数的格式字符是【】;以十进制无符号形式输出整数的格式字符是【】。
随机试题
A.呆小症B.巨人症C.侏儒症D.阿狄森病肾上腺皮质功能低下可引起
肺常见的球形病灶中,钙化特征不正确的
关于井巷工程辅助费,不正确的说法是()。
下列说法正确的是()。
_____ofmytwobrothers_____goodatEnglish.
雾霾问题是个棘手难题,但再棘手也得解决,而且难题破解还得摁下“快进键”。虽然从客观规律上看,治霾难______,可就紧迫性而言,治霾还必须得“______”,抓住那些核心症结对症施治。填入画横线部分最恰当的一项是:
阅读以下说明回答问题1-4。[说明]某网站欲办一个论坛,试回答下列问题。
使用VC6打开考生文件夹下的源程序文件modil.cpp,该程序运行时有错,请改正其中的错误,使程序正常运行,并使程序输出的结果为:TestClass2TestClass3注意:不要改动main函数,不能增行或删行,也不能更改
What’stheweatherlikenow?
A、Mr.KellywillbeinParisonThursday.B、Mr.KellywillattendameetingonThursday.C、Mr.Kellywillprobablymeetthisman
最新回复
(
0
)